Winter Storm Battlefield: Strategic Combat

0 comments

Winter Storm is a 5v5 team-based combat mode that opens for servers older than 7 weeks. Battles traditionally take place on Saturdays, and an additional day, Monday, is added during off-season periods. The schedule is subject to change based on game updates, so players should always check the exact timing in the event menu.

1. Time Intervals and Participation

Participation is restricted to specific time windows during the event day:

  • Time Windows: There are 3 windows of 2 hours each available for participation.
  • Matchmaking: After registration, the system begins searching for allies and opponents.
  • Entering the Battle: Once a team of 10 commanders is formed and all participants confirm readiness, players are automatically transported to the battlefield.

2. Limits and Reward System

The number of valuable prizes per event is limited:

  • Reward Limit: You can claim a maximum of 3 win rewards and 3 participation rewards.
  • Important Note: A win automatically counts as participation. By achieving three victories, you will complete both reward tracks simultaneously.
  • Honor Points: Three victories grant a total of 10,000 Honor Points Honor Points, which are required to purchase Gear Blueprints (UR) in the event shop.

3. Troop Preparation and Conditions

The event is highly resource-efficient as it does not consume your real army:

  • Requirements: Commanders with Headquarters (HQ) level 15 and above can participate.
  • Army: Upon entering, your highest-level units automatically fill an independent Drill Ground. These troops do not appear in your main base.
  • Free Recovery: Units do not die permanently; all severely wounded soldiers are automatically recovered for free immediately after the match.

4. Key Objects and Victory Conditions

The battle continues until one team reaches 30,000 points, or until 10 minutes expire. In practice, 30,000 points are usually reached faster (about 7–8 minutes).

Oil Refinery
  • Oil Refinery
    • Can be captured immediately after the battle starts.
    • Primary source of points. There are two of them on the map.
Missile Site
  • Missile Site
    • Automatically attacks captured enemy buildings and deals damage to the troops inside.
    • Grants a small number of points. There are two of them on the map.
Nuclear Silo
  • Nuclear Silo
    • Becomes available 3 minutes after the battle starts.
    • Key object that grants a large number of points.
Airdrop Supplies
  • Airdrop Supplies
    • Periodically appears in different locations on the map.
    • The team receives 1,000 points for capturing the supplies.

5. Tactics and Relocation Mechanics

  • Garrison: Each commander can place multiple squads in a single building, which is impossible on the game's main map.
  • Marching: Once troops are sent, you cannot change their direction; only the "Return to base" command is available.
  • Free Teleport: Moving your base on the battlefield is free and available once per minute.
  • Lifehack: Teleportation allows you to instantly gather all your troops—whether they are marching or in a garrison—directly back to your base for regrouping.

Conclusion

Winter Storm requires high concentration and the ability to change positions rapidly. Despite random matchmaking, the vital Honor Points Honor Points make participation mandatory for any player aiming for top-tier gear.
